Anatomy of a Motorcycle Wheel Bearing

Wheel bearings consist of inner and outer races, precision-engineered to fit snugly on the axle and hub. In between these races, tiny balls or tapered rollers distribute the weight of the motorcycle and enable smooth rotation. The entire assembly is encased in a sealed housing, protecting it from contaminants and ensuring proper lubrication.

Types of Motorcycle Wheel Bearings

  • Ball Bearings: The most common type, featuring spherical balls for low-friction rolling.
  • Tapered Roller Bearings: Utilize cone-shaped rollers to handle higher loads and prevent axial movement.
  • Needle Bearings: Thin, cylindrical rollers that offer high load capacity in limited space.

Signs of Worn Motorcycle Wheel Bearings

Neglecting wheel bearings can lead to serious consequences. Here are common signs of wear to watch out for:

  • Grinding or Humming Noise: Worn bearings produce a grinding or humming sound while riding.
  • Excessive Play in the Wheels: Worn bearings allow for excessive play, resulting in wobbling or instability.
  • Heat Buildup: Friction from worn bearings generates heat, which can damage other components.
  • Vibration: Worn bearings cause vibrations felt through the handlebars or footpegs.

Maintaining Motorcycle Wheel Bearings

Proper maintenance is crucial to prolong the life of wheel bearings. Follow these guidelines:

  • Regular Inspection: Check bearings for signs of wear during routine maintenance.
  • Lubrication: Use high-quality motorcycle grease to lubricate bearings regularly.
  • Cleaning: Remove dirt and debris from bearings using a degreaser or bearing cleaner.
  • Replacement: Replace worn bearings promptly to prevent further damage.

Tips and Tricks

  • Use a torque wrench to tighten axle nuts to the manufacturer's specifications.
  • Avoid pressure washing directly onto bearings, as water can penetrate the seals.
  • Install wheel spacers to prevent excessive bearing preload.
  • Regularly inspect and clean the wheel bearings on your motorcycle.
